Our verdict is Pathogenic. Variant got 14 ACMG points: 14P and 0B. PVS1_StrongPM2PP5_Very_Strong
The NM_177965.4(CFAP418):c.555G>A(p.Trp185*) variant causes a stop gained change involving the alteration of a con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.00000274 in 1,461,850 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, with no homozygous occurrence. In-silico tool predicts a pathogenic out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Likely pathogenic (★★).

Genes affected
CFAP418 (HGNC:27232): (cilia and flagella associated protein 418) This gene encodes a ubiquitously expressed protein of unknown function. It has high levels of mRNA expression in the brain, heart, and retina and the protein co-localizes with polyglutamylated tubulin at the base of the primary cilium in human retinal pigment epithelial cells. Mutations in this gene have been associated with autosomal recessive cone-rod dystrophy (arCRD) and retinitis pigmentosa (arRP). [provided by RefSeq, Mar 2012]

Verdict is Pathogenic. Variant got 14 ACMG points.
PVS1
Loss of function variant, product does not undergo nonsense mediated mRNA decay. Variant is located in the 3'-most exon, not predicted to undergo nonsense mediated mRNA decay. Fraction of 0.111 CDS is truncated, and there are 1 pathogenic variants in the truncated region.
PM2
Very rare variant in population databases, with high coverage;

Likely p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itter | clinical testing | GeneDx | Mar 10, 2023 | Nonsense variant in the C-terminus predicted to result in protein truncation, as the last 23 amino acids are lost, and other loss-of-function variants have been reported downstream in the Human Gene Mutation Database (HGMD); Not observed at a significant frequency in large population cohorts (gnomAD); This variant is associated with the following publications: (PMID: 25802487, 29843741, 31980526) - |
P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itter | clinical testing | Labcorp Genetics (formerly Invitae), Labcorp | Aug 16, 2022 | For these reasons, this variant has been classified as Pathogenic. This variant disrupts a region of the C8orf37 protein in which other variant(s) (p.Trp202*) have been determined to be pathogenic (Invitae). This suggests that this is a clinically significant region of the protein, and that variants that disrupt it are likely to be disease-causing. ClinVar contains an entry for this variant (Variation ID: 417788). This premature translational stop signal has been observed in individual(s) with clinical features of inherited retinal dystrophy (PMID: 25802487, 29843741). It has also been observed to segregate with disease in related individuals. This variant is present in population databases (rs748014296, gnomAD 0.002%). This sequence change creates a premature translational stop signal (p.Trp185*) in the C8orf37 gene. While this is not anticipated to result in nonsense mediated decay, it is expected to disrupt the last 23 amino acid(s) of the C8orf37 protein. - |
